About Snack Attack
Snack Attack is a casual fast-food establishment situated on Castleford Road in Normanton, West Yorkshire, catering to those looking for a convenient bite to eat. It operates as a popular local spot, known for its quick service and straightforward menu of classic takeaway favourites.
The menu at Snack Attack typically features a selection of morning and lunchtime staples, including various sandwiches and hot snacks. Customers frequently appreciate the overall convenience and the competitive pricing of the food available. This busy spot aims to provide a reliable option for workers and residents in the surrounding area who need a speedy meal.
Visiting Information
Snack Attack welcomes customers throughout the week, opening early from 6:30 AM. On weekdays (Monday to Friday), it closes at 2:00 PM. On Saturdays, it operates until 1:00 PM, and on Sundays, it closes slightly earlier at 12:00 PM. For payment, the establishment accepts debit cards and NFC payments, making transactions quick and easy. Please note that there is no wheelchair accessible entrance at this venue.
